Question 1178760: The height of babies are normally distributed with a mean of 65 centimeter and a standard deviation of 9 centimeter. find the percentage of the followong baby heights
- less than 54 centimeter
-at least 80 centimeter (more)
-between 70 and 86 centimer (between)

Answer by ewatrrr(24785) About Me  (Show Source):
You can put this solution on YOUR website!

Hi
normally distributed:  µ = 65 and σ = 9
Using a TI 0r similarly an inexpensive calculator like Casio fx-115 ES plus:
Continuous curve:
P(x < 54) = P(x ≤ 54) =  normalcdf(-9999,54,65,9) = .1108
P(x> 80) = 1 - P(x ≤ 80) = 1 - normalcdf(-9999,80,65,9) = 1- .9522 = .1478
P(70 < x < 86) = normalcdf(70,86,65,9) = .2794
